Black Cat , along the first alley to
the right west off Hanzhong Lu after the
Guanjia Qiao intersection, near Xinjiekou.
(A tall metal telephone pole marks the mouth
of the alley.) You can get a superb meal of
steak, chips and as much salad as you can
eat here for just „40. There is another
branch around the corner in the Great Eagle
Building.
Chaozhou , in the Nanjing Hotel
compound on Zhongshan Bei Lu. Banquet-style
Chaozhounese cuisine, such as the delicious chongcao
(a vegetable whose shape vaguely resembles
an insect) and jiayu (a member of the
tortoise family).
Daniang Shuijiao , in the basement
of the Xinjiekou Department Store. More than
forty varieties of cheap and filling
dumplings on offer here, most for under „5
each.
Fatty Cooked Wheaten Food King ,
Ninghai Lu right across from the Nanjing
Normal University entrance. The wonderful
name is almost reason enough to visit this
friendly joint, offering inexpensive Chinese
snacks, hotpots and noodles. Foreign
students regard their xiaolongbao
(pork-filled dumplings) as the best on the
block.
Fusheng Yuan , Yunnan Lu just off
Hunan Lu. Dishes up Nanjing and Yangzhou
specialities in pleasant surroundings.
Locals especially go for the excellent
hotpot.
Gold and Silver , Jinying Lu just
off Shanghai Lu. The best of a number of
Chinese restaurants catering to the Nanjing
University students. Their mantou
(fried dough with condensed milk) makes an
excellent dessert.
Haitian Ge , 179 Zhongyang Lu,
just north of the Hunan Lu intersection and
opposite Xuanwu Hu. Reasonable prices and
very popular with locals - this place is
packed from 5pm onwards. Jiangsu and Beijing
fare, especially salted duck, are the
specialities, but the kitchen also makes
several Macanese (from Macau) dishes that
are well worth trying.
Hefeng , 75 Zhongshan Lu, in the Central
Hotel. Wonderfully presented and
deliciously inexpensive Japanese food. You
could eat your fill of sushi here for under
„50.
Henry's , 33 Huaqiao Lu. Tasty
pasta, salad, steak and burger dishes, most
for under „25. The accommodating waitstaff
allow students to bring in their own movies
to watch.
Jack's , corner of Jinying Lu and
Shanghai Lu, directly across from the
Nanjing University foreign students'
dormitory. Inexpensive Western and Japanese
food in a trendy setting, this is where many
foreign students congregate during the day.
There is a new branch open directly across
the street from the Nanjing Normal
University main gate.
Jiangsu , 26 Jiankang Lu, just
east of Zhonghua Lu in Fuzi Miao near the
Taiping Museum. One of the most upmarket
places to try local food - pressed, salted
duck is a speciality.
Jiaozi Wang , Ninghai Lu near the
intersection with Guangzhou Lu near the
Normal University. Another excellent-value
dumpling place, with every imaginable type
of jiaozi available. A student
favourite.
Jinzhu , 204 Zhongshan Bei Lu, on
the north side between Xin Mofan Malu and
the Hunan Lu traffic circle. Locals pack
this family joint offering Jiangsu
specialities at very reasonable prices -
most dishes, even specials, are under „30.
Ask about the excellent seafood specials,
which are constantly changing.
Lao Zhengxing , 119 Gongyuan Jie,
near Fuzi Miao. A traditional, lively place
with interesting local dishes, backing onto
the river. A favourite of Kuomintang
officials in the 1930s.
Musilin Noodles , Ninghai Lu, near
Hankou Xi Lu and the Normal University front
gate. Cheap, filling Xinjiang-style lamian
(pulled noodles). A student favourite.
New York , New York ,
corner of Hunan Lu and Yunnan Lu north of
Gulou. Standard American buffet-style food.
The „49 all-you-can-eat lunch and dinner
specials are quite good value.
Shanghai Tan , on a small alley
directly behind the Central Hotel off
Guanjia Qiao, near Xinjiekou. Excellent
Shanghainese cuisine with the odd Jiangsu
dish ( yanshui ya) thrown in. The
seafood is especially good. Very popular
with locals.
Swede and Kraut , 137 Ninghai Lu,
upstairs. Expensive but excellent pasta,
salads and breads in an intimate setting.
The pasta and bread are all homemade - the
lasagna and fettucini especially are
scrumptious. Run by a genteel European
couple.
Tianyuan Longjuan , Gaolou, one
block northeast of Gulou. Small, family-run
restaurant with an incredible deal on beijing
kaoya (Beijing duck) - „30 for two
people including the duck, soup, and
garnishes.
Xiao Ren Ren , 97 Gongyuan Jie, in
Fuzi Miao. Friendly place designed in the
style of a traditional tea house, with
musicians serenading patrons. You can try a
smorgasbord of local delicacies for just „38.
Yinghua Yuan , Guanjia Qiao, just
off Hanzhong Lu, underground (a staircase
from the pavement leads down to it).
Intimate decor and reasonably priced,
scrumptious Jiangsu and Shanghainese food
make this one of the most popular
restaurants in town with locals. The wild
rabbit stew is a perennial favourite.
